American rapper, Meek Mill seems to be finding it hard moving on from his broken relationship to rapper, Nicki Minaj six months after both rappers parted ways.

Meek Mill who was accused of stealing $200,000 worth of jewelries from the rapper following their separation admitted that he made a mistake breaking up with her in a latest interview.

Speaking during an interview with Philadelphia Power 99 Philly radio station recently, the Philadelphia rapper, 30, admitted that breaking up with Nicki Minaj was a loss to him.

He also talked about his new album which he titled ‘Wins and Losses’, an apt title for his loss.

The rapper admitted that dating the female rapper had been his a life-long goal.

He said: “It was a win. I got Nicki when I was… like I came up. I always wanted Nicki my whole life. I used to talk…remember I had the rap about it. I bagged that. So that was a win of course.”

Speaking on how he felt after they broke up, he added: “Of course breaking up with anyone you love is a loss. Period. Game time. Want me to make up a lie or something? It’s so easy to tell the truth now.”

Recall that the female rapper had in January confirmed their split after she took to her social media page on Twitter to write: ‘To confirm, yes I am single.”

Nicki some weeks ago confirmed she was dating rapper, Nas, stating that he is her king, a well deserved score.
